Abstract :
The security mechanism of LTE system, which provides radio communication and its services with secure network, is much more perfect than that of 3G. This paper puts forward a novel method for key derivation based on the idea of combination of vulnerabilities in both radio interface and core-network in perspective of eavesdropper. The radio child-keys are produced according to the security algorithm list provided by plain radio message and parent-key obtained, and the right key is decided by comparing the plain context with the decrypted context. It is proved that the radio child-key is able to be obtained in this way according to the analysis of feasibility and complexity.
